One of the key advantages of chlorine is its ability to provide residual disinfection. This means that even after the initial treatment, some chlorine remains in the water as it travels through pipelines to consumers. This residual effect continues to defend against any potential contamination that might occur along the way. However, it is essential to monitor chlorine levels carefully, as high concentrations can lead to unpleasant tastes and odors, as well as the formation of potentially harmful chlorinated byproducts.

The synthesis of triethylene glycol diacetate typically involves the reaction of triethylene glycol with acetic anhydride or acetic acid in the presence of an acid catalyst. This esterification process allows for the formation of TEGDA while releasing water as a byproduct. By controlling the reaction conditions, such as temperature and the ratio of reactants, manufacturers can optimize the yield and purity of the final product. Understanding these synthesis methods is crucial for industries aiming for efficient production and quality control.

Moreover, in the realm of biotechnology, PAM is used in gel electrophoresis, a vital technique for DNA analysis, protein separation, and other biochemical studies. The gel matrix formed by polyacrylamide allows researchers to effectively separate biomolecules based on size, providing critical insight into genetic and protein characteristics.

CoQ10 is a naturally occurring antioxidant found in every cell of the body, primarily in the mitochondria, where it plays a critical role in the production of adenosine triphosphate (ATP), the energy currency of the cell. As we age, the levels of CoQ10 tend to decline, which can lead to decreased energy production and an increased risk of various health issues. Supplementing with CoQ10 has been associated with improved energy levels, enhanced athletic performance, and potential benefits for heart health.

Given their critical role, APIs must meet stringent quality standards to ensure patient safety and therapeutic efficacy. Regulatory agencies like the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) and the European Medicines Agency (EMA) enforce guidelines that govern the development and manufacturing of APIs. This includes the necessity for rigorous testing to demonstrate purity, potency, and stability. Manufacturers must also provide comprehensive documentation, including master production and control records, to demonstrate compliance with regulatory standards.
Another significant advantage of isoflurane anesthesia is its cardiovascular stability. Unlike other anesthetic agents that may cause significant depressant effects on heart rate or blood pressure, isoflurane maintains hemodynamic parameters within acceptable ranges when administered correctly. This is particularly important in research involving cardiovascular studies, where maintaining physiological baseline conditions is critical.

api abbreviation pharmaOnce an API is developed, it undergoes rigorous testing to ensure its safety and efficacy. This includes preclinical studies, often conducted in vitro (in test tubes) and in vivo (in live organisms), followed by multiple phases of clinical trials with human subjects. Each phase aims to assess different aspects, such as dosage safety, effectiveness, and adverse effects. This stringency is crucial, as even small changes in the API's chemistry can significantly affect the drug's performance and safety profile.

Following coagulation, the next step is flocculation, where flocculants are added to assist in the aggregation of flocs. These are typically long-chain organic polymers that stabilize the flocs, making them larger and more effective at settling out of the water. The use of flocculants improves the overall efficiency of the sedimentation process, leading to clearer water.
